This doesn’t mean the player ranked second is a better fit for your roster construction then the player ranked third or fourth, but it is a way of valuing assets and setting expectations for what you should receive in return for a trade. ![]() In order to provide one comprehensive list, I decided to rank dynasty quarterbacks by ordering them based on the maximum return you should expect to receive if you traded the player in a dynasty league. While there’s value in sitting in between and hoping to find a few breakout stars to move you into championship contention, I prefer the route of either saying I’m “going for it” or tearing it down and acquiring assets. The best approach to dynasty rankings is to have two lists: one set of rankings for teams competing this year and next and another list for teams in the rebuild phase. In my re-draft leagues, I will take Garoppolo at his 94.1 ADP every single day over Watson at 46.3, but in dynasty the thought of having 10-plus years of Watson as a Top 5 QB is so much more valuable then the upside Jimmy G offers. The difference in value between DeShaun Watson and Jimmy Garoppolo is a perfect example. The difference between the third and 10th ranked quarterbacks in redraft formats is so small it’s advantageous to wait, but dynasty quarterbacks get a significant boost in value due to their longevity at the top of the position. For both professional and fantasy football, quarterbacks are the longest term asset in the sport and provide the flexibility to keep your championship window open for an extended period of time.
